## Service Accounts: TaxRate Lookup Cache

The Fennwick tax-rate lookup cache (internally called RateVault) sits between the Ledgerline billing service and the regional rates database. New team members should note that all reads go through the `svc-ratevault-reader` service account, which has read-only scope and rotates quarterly. Never reuse this account for writes; the writer account is managed separately by the Calderos platform team. To run the cache locally against staging, you authenticate with the shared staging credential shown below.

API key for yahig-tadup: kto7_ubizbYm

## Deployment Notes — Build Agent Time Sync

For the sync: we traced the intermittent artifact-signing failures on the Quillmere build farm to clock skew between agents. Some agents drifted up to 40 seconds, which broke timestamp validation during promotion. The fix deployed last week installs a sync daemon on every agent and rejects builds from hosts drifting more than 500ms. Rollout is complete across all three pools; the Oakfen pool needed a second pass after image rebuilds. Each agent's daemon now runs with the configuration values below.

deployment values, kajep-kageg:
[praix]
host = praix.paliqcorp.corp
user = praix_svc
database = praix_prod

Q4 Planning Note — Legacy Pricing Adjustment

Sales leads: effective next quarter, legacy customers on the pre-2021 Lanternfall plans will see a staged 9% price increase, applied at renewal rather than mid-term. Talk tracks should emphasize the feature parity these accounts now receive at below-market rates. Expect pushback from the Westbrook cohort; escalation paths go through Priya Tamm. Discount authority is capped at 4% without director sign-off. The broader reasoning for this adjustment is captured in the note below.

management briefing: Jorixax Holdings is in early talks to buy Casixax Holdings for about $420.3 million. The Fenmir launch date is October 27, and nothing goes to the press before then. Legal wants the Keloxek Foods term sheet redrafted before April 16.